Wooden Veranda Construction in Fairfield County, CT

Wooden veranda construction involves designing and building outdoor structures that extend from a home’s main entrance or patio area, providing a functional and aesthetic addition to the property. These projects typically include creating new verandas, replacing or repairing existing ones, and customizing designs to match the style of the home.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ance curb appeal, create a welcoming outdoor space, or add value to their property. Before requesting veranda constru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, the types of wood suitable for durability and appearance, and any design options available to match their home's architecture.

It is also common for property owners to inquire about the materials used, the construction process, and how the new structure will integrate with existing outdoor features. Clarifying details such as size, layout, and decorative elements helps ensure the project aligns with their vision. Additionally, understanding the necessary permits or approvals required by local regulations can be important steps before beginning construction. This service offers a way to create a charming, functional outdoor space that complements the home while meeting individual preferences and needs.

FAQ

Wooden Veranda Construction Questions

What materials are commonly used for wooden verandas? Typically, pressure-treated lumber, cedar, and redwood are popular choices for durability and appearance.

Can a wooden veranda be customized to match existing outdoor features? Yes, designs can be tailored to complement the style and layout of the property.

What are the benefits of choosing a wooden veranda? Wooden verandas add natural charm, provide outdoor living space, and can enhance property value.

Is it possible to add features like railings or built-in seating? Yes, additional features such as railings, benches, and decorative elements can be incorporated into the design.
